## Runbook: vendoring third-party fonts in Glyphbox plugins

Quick reminder: don't hotlink fonts from external CDNs — the sandbox blocks outbound fetches, and your plugin will render fallback serif and look sad. Instead, vendor the font files into your plugin bundle under `assets/fonts/` and declare them in your manifest. The packager checks license metadata at build time, so include it. The bundler reads its limits from these settings.

deployment values, taweg-bajop:
[fenvan]
port = 5672
team = holmir
host = fenvan.orvexio.example
region = lower-1
access_code = ac_b98bc6
timeout_ms = 1500

Q3 Planning — Sales Leads

Training budget for next year is set at 4% of regional payroll, down from 5%. Prioritize negotiation workshops over product refreshers. Submit team requests by end of Q3; late entries roll to mid-year. Vantrell certification costs now come from central, not branch funds. See the confidential note below before briefing your teams.

internal memo for fajog-yagaf: Gross margin on Ulaael came in at 20 percent against a plan of 10 percent. Only 9 of the 80 pilot accounts renewed Ulaael, so a churn review is set for July 1.

## Tuning

Dark-mode in the Ferrowick admin dashboard is driven by a small set of theme constants rather than scattered overrides. When reviewing, check that contrast ratios and transition timings come from this table only; hardcoded hex values should be flagged. The toggle debounce and preference-sync interval also live here. All current values are listed below.

constants for tafog-kahag:
RATE_LIMITS = {
    "sorir": 697,
    "oliox": 683,
    "holax": 176,
    "casox": 60,
    "pelius": 382,
}

Verify that the undo stack correctly reverses compound operations (group moves, multi-select deletes, and connector reroutes) as single steps, and that redo replays them identically. Confirm the stack is capped at 200 entries with oldest-first eviction, and that stack state is discarded — never persisted — on document close. Known gap: undo across collaborative sessions is intentionally unsupported; document this in any findings. Discrepancies should be reported to the accountable maintainer listed here.

account owner for bawip-tahag: Raleth Quenok